Negrense equestrienne shines in international showjumping tilt

June 24, 2025

Young Negrense equestrienne Sophia Begre-Lacson has recently concluded three weeks of training and competition in Indonesia, where she finished in eighth place out of 39 riders in the 0.95-1.05 meter category at the National Showjumping Competition in Jakarta Equestrian Park.

Negros Weekly news magazine was founded on November 11, 2000 by a group of civic leaders and local journalists headed by Journalism Professor Allen V. Del Carmen. The publication offers news, features, and opinion articles for Negros Occidental readers. It also accepts printing jobs, graphic designs, legal notices and ad placements.*
